"Wonderful mix of all kinds of aliens!"
In this story, we have the pleasure of revisiting
characters we were introduced to in ZORROC. In ZORROC,
Prince Sherem of Nefar, a neighboring kingdom of Gattonia,
helped Zorroc successfully deal with his enemies. In the
process, he happened to see Zorroc's little sister,
Princess Nadia. As soon as they met, Sherem knew Nadia was
destined to be his mate, however, convincing her of that
turns out to be much harder than he thought. Sherem is a
true warrior and has no time for a gentle wooing.
Especially now with all the threats against him. While
going to deal with the Horta people, Sherem was attacked. A
young ankou helped him and became his best friend. The
ankou are a mysterious race. They are much bigger than a
dog and can become invisible. The ankou, Bran, can also
mind speak with Sherem. And if that attack wasn't enough,
Sherem also has an assassin after him, one he thinks his
brother, Dakar, sent. Even though Sherem's kiss inflamed Nadia, she has no
intentions of becoming his mate. She fully intends to marry
only for love and nothing else will suffice. Fortunately,
Zorroc backs her up in this. Naturally, when Zorroc takes
his family on a trip to Earth and doesn't report in when he
supposed to, the Council won't take her seriously and
refuse to do anything. Nadia knows something is wrong and
the only one she can think of turning to for help is
Sherem. Of course, Sherem has a condition in return for his
aid. Nadia must accompany him on his ship. Since Nadia was
planning on going all along, she agrees. Then Dakar shows up at Nadia's home and tells her Sherem
has arranged to meet her at another planet. Without
question, Nadia accompanies Sherem's brother, never
realizing Dakar is getting back at Sherem for his lack of
trust. When Sherem finally catches up with Nadia and his
brother, he is approached by the queen. She informs Sherem
of a major drug trafficking problem. Now Sherem has to not
only deal with keeping Nadia safe, the assassination
attempts, he also has to take care of this drug problem,
all the while keeping an eye on his brother. Who is behind the assassination attempts? Is it really
Dakar, Sherem's brother? Does it have anything to do with
the drug? And what of the stormy relationship between Nadia
and Sherem? Will they ever mate? FELINE PREDATORS OF GANZ 2: SHEREM is a wonderful science
fiction romance. Lil Gibson has once again woven her magic
in bringing two very disparate people together. Take one
very alpha male, add a very spoiled princess, and the
mixture becomes explosive between these two. Add to this an
outgoing brother in Dakar, an invisible ankou and the
action never stops! This is a very good, thrilling read and
I highly recommend it.
